Does anyone have any idea how he is able to fully isolate all the iso booths with just those doors?
Hey Abin, Full isolation is difficult to achieve unless you have the budget, real estate and contractor to pull it off. There is often a small amount of bleed when I'm tracking. Normally that creates zero issues when it comes time to mix. If I run into an issue where bleed starts to become problematic, I will space out my sound sources as far apart as possible using the furthest booths. If this does not work, I'll rely on tracking in layers saving the more subtle instruments for last. This will allow more isolation if needed. Hope this answers your question!
